rc_buffer_size doesn't really have a meaning to a decoder (its for
encoders and muxers), so why should it not be able to change it to
match the value it reads from the bitstream?
- Hendrik
> De : ffmpeg-devel <ffmpeg-devel-bounces@ffmpeg.org> De la part de Hendrik Leppkes > Envoyé : lundi 24 février 2020 17:26 > À : FFmpeg development discussions and patches <ffmpeg-devel@ffmpeg.org> > Objet : Re: [FFmpeg-devel] [PATCH] avcodec/mpeg12dec: Do not alter avctx->rc_buffer_size > > On Mon, Feb 24, 2020 at 5:13 PM Nicolas Gaullier > <nicolas.gaullier@cji.paris> wrote: > > > > rc_buffer_size doesn't really have a meaning to a decoder (its for > encoders and muxers), so why should it not be able to change it to > match the value it reads from the bitstream? > > - Hendrik Both because it is not helpful : a later patch will make the value available as side data, and because API doc (avcodec.h) says "decoding: unused". The other way would have been to update the doc etc., but it does not seem relevant here. This comes from a previous review by James and I agreed with him not to change the API. As soon as this patch is applied, I will send my updated v4 patchset "Fix mpeg1/2 stream copy" which will allow reading rc_buffer_size through side data.
